How Spring Health unlocked 30–40% cloud savings with a zero-downtime AWS migration
Spring Health Challenges
Spring Health’s customer base doubled year over year. Their previous infrastructure provider was built for developer productivity but imposed hard limits: container caps, single-service autoscaling, and daily backups that risked up to 24 hours of data loss. As the engineering team grew 50%, the DevOps team stayed flat.
Spring Health started on bare metal, moved to a PaaS provider that offered generous developer productivity but limited flexibility, and eventually needed more control. The PaaS approach worked well for years, but as the team needed to build more products, integrate AI/ML workloads, and operate at scale, the constraints became untenable.
The challenge intensified with the rise of AI. Spring Health’s continuous care model relies on rapid iteration: building, testing, learning, and repeating across a complex landscape of legal requirements, clinical validation, and shifting regulations. Without infrastructure that provided visibility and flexibility, the team was stuck.
DuploCloud Solutions
Since working with DuploCloud, Spring Health has transformed its entire cloud infrastructure and DevOps capability.
DuploCloud guided Spring Health through a complete migration from a legacy PaaS provider to AWS while simultaneously ensuring HIPAA compliance and gathering evidence for HITRUST recertification. The migration was not just a lift-and-shift; it involved a complete architectural modernization executed in just four months.
Spring Health transitioned from a platform with hard container limits and single-service autoscaling to a fully scalable AWS environment running Aurora RDS, OpenSearch, SageMaker, and Bedrock. Infrastructure deployment is now automated and HIPAA-compliant by default, enabling teams to self-serve without waiting on DevOps.
Instead of scaling their DevOps team linearly with engineering growth, Spring Health leveraged DuploCloud’s AI-powered agents to handle incident triage, root cause analysis, and infrastructure operations autonomously. The platform replaced manual rules engines with LLM-driven automation, keeping safety guardrails in place while offloading 80% of operational decision-making to AI.
Impact for Spring Health
All of this transformation enables Spring Health to:
- Achieve 99.9% SLA for always-on mental health services, ensuring no patient is left waiting.
- Reduce cloud spend by 30-40% while massively expanding AI/ML capabilities post-migration.
- Operate at a 1:50 DevOps-to-engineer ratio, far surpassing the industry standard of 1:20-30.
- Expand from 6 to 15 environments, with data platform and AI/ML teams self-serving infrastructure deployment.
- Reduce maximum data loss from 24 hours to just one minute with Aurora RDS.
- Improve overall performance by 10-20%, with up to 2x gains for specific services like OpenSearch.
